Tolu-ene Chemical Specification

  • Structural Formula
  • C6H5CH3
  • Smell
  • Sweet, pungent, benzene-like odor, Sweet, aromatic odor
  • Molecular Formula
  • C7H8
  • Melting Point
  • -95C
  • Solubility
  • Insoluble in water, soluble in ethanol, ether, acetone, benzene
  • Other Names
  • Methylbenzene, Phenylmethane
  • Shape
  • Liquid, Liquid
  • Storage
  • Store in c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from oxidizing agents, Store in cool, ventilated, dry area, away from sources of ignition
  • HS Code
  • 29023000
  • Density
  • 0.8669 Gram per cubic centimeter(g/cm3)
  • Boiling point
  • 110.6C
  • Form
  • Clear liquid, Liquid
  • Refractive Rate
  • 1.4969 at 20C
  • Molecular Weight
  • 92.14 g/mol
  • Poisonous
  • Yes
  • Ph Level
  • Neutral
  • Purity
  • 99.8% min
  • Classification
  • Hydrocarbon, Solvent, Flammable Liquid
  • Chemical Name
  • Toluene
  • CAS No
  • 108-88-3
  • EINECS No
  • 203-625-9
  • Grade
  • Industrial Grade, Industrial Grade
  • Standard
  • Conforms to industry standards
  • Type
  • Aromatic hydrocarbon
  • Usage
  • Used in adhesives, paints, coatings, chemical manufacturing
  • Main Material
  • Toluene (C7H8)
  • Application
  • Industrial solvent, chemical synthesis, fuel additive, paint thinner, Used as an industrial solvent and in chemical synthesis
  • Non Toxic
  • Yes
  • Percent Volatile
  • 100%
  • Appearance
  • Clear, colorless liquid
  • Autoignition Temperature
  • 480 C
  • Viscosity
  • 0.59 mPas (20 C)
  • Evaporation Rate
  • 2.24 (butyl acetate=1)
  • Shelf Life
  • 2 years in unopened container
  • Vapor Pressure
  • 28.4 mmHg (25 C)
  • Flash Point
  • 4 C (closed cup)
  • Packing
  • Steel drum, IBC tank, bulk

FAQ's of Tolu-ene Chemical:


Q: How should Tolu-ene Chemical be stored for maximum shelf life?

A: Store Tolu-ene Chemical in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area, away from sources of ignition and oxidizing agents. Keep containers tightly sealed to maintain its 2-year shelf life.

Q: What are the main industrial applications of Tolu-ene Chemical?

A: Tolu-ene Chemical is extensively used as a solvent in adhesives, paints, coatings, chemical synthesis, fuel additives, and as a paint thinner in various industries.

Q: When is it appropriate to use Tolu-ene as a solvent?

A: Use Tolu-ene as a solvent during processes requiring fast evaporation, strong dissolving power, and compatibility with ethanol, ether, acetone, and benzene, but not for applications where water solubility is needed.
